Kafakumba Clinic: Kafakumba Clinic is a mission-oriented health facility with a passion for improving health outcomes in our community. You will join a supportive team dedicated to excellence, innovation, and service.
Location: Kafakumba Clinic (Along the Ndola – Kitwe Dual Carriageway)
Start Date: As soon as available
Type: Full-time
About the Clinic Administrator Role
The Clinic Administrator will oversee the daily operations of the clinic, ensure efficient and high-quality service delivery, support our clinical teams, and actively uphold our mission and vision. This is a key leadership position requiring strong organizational, interpersonal, and management skills.
Key Responsibilities
- Provide overall administrative leadership for clinic operations
- Manage staffing schedules, human resources processes, and staff development
- Oversee financial planning, budgeting, and reporting
- Ensure compliance with national health regulations and licensing requirements
- Maintain facility standards, procurement systems, and inventory controls
- Support quality improvement initiatives and patient-centered care practices
- Collaborate closely with clinical leadership and community partners
- Represent the clinic in external meetings and stakeholder engagement
Qualifications
- Minimum 5 years of administrative or management experience, preferably in a healthcare setting
- Strong leadership, communication, and problem-solving skills
- Ability to work effectively with a multidisciplinary team
- Experience in budgeting, HR management, and operations oversight
- Knowledge of Zambian health systems is an advantage
- Commitment to ethical, compassionate, and community-focused healthcare
